EEL 604
Supervision and the Improvement of Teaching and Learning
Pace University ·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
This course focuses on the role of the supervisor or teacher-mentor in bringing about changes about desirable changes in teaching and learning. Use is made of significant research and best practice to explore the areas of promoting human potential, communication, the measurement of classroom behavior, the utilization of a variety of techniques to promote teacher self-analysis and assisting teachers to deal with innovative approaches in curriculum and instruction, including the use of modern technology. The tension between curriculum development and evaluation is also highlighted in this course and the role of professional development will also be explored. The course will also apply knowledge of adult learning principles and motivation theory to ensure appropriate and effective professional development opportunities. PL: Fall, Spring, and Summer.
